如何设置自适应网站建设,让访问速度更快、体验更佳?
- 内容介绍
- 相关推荐
一句话概括... 互联网早已不是那个只属于大屏幕桌面的世界了。你有没有想过当用户在地铁上、在排队买咖啡时掏出手机点开你的网站,他们期待的是什么?不仅仅是信息的获取,更是一种行云流水的快感。如果网页加载慢吞吞,或者布局乱七八糟,用户的心里恐怕早就默默关掉了页面。这就是为什么我们今天要聊一聊“自适应网站建设”这个话题。这不仅仅是一个技术活,更是一场关于用户体验的博弈。
一、 自适应网站:不仅仅是屏幕的缩小
常说的自适应网站,其实是指同一站点、同一页面可以在电脑、手机、平板和各类设备上正常浏览的站点。听起来很美好,对吧?但很多网站的做法是对不同终端设计多个网页,这简直是维护的噩梦。试想一下你要维护两套甚至三套代码,一旦有个新闻要更新,你得改好几遍,这谁受得了,吃瓜。?
所以 聪明的做法是设计一个简单的“盒子”,这个盒子可以识别不同的终端而显示不同的效果。移动设备正超过桌面设备,成为访问互联网的最常见终端。如果你的网站不能适应这种变化,那就像是在智能手机时代还坚持用BP机一样, 闹笑话。 显得格格不入。通过自适应网站提升品牌形象, 使之符合时代的节拍,让品牌保持新鲜感和吸引力,从而使品牌焕发出新的生命活力,是品牌能够持续发展的关键。
1. 那个神奇的Viewport标签
自适应网页设计到底是做到的?其实并不难,但有一个前提,那就是你得告诉浏览器:“嘿, 绝了... 别假装自己是电脑,请按照手机屏幕的宽度来显示。”
先说说 在网页代码的头部,加入一行 viewport元标签:。这行代码的意思是 网页宽度默认等于屏幕宽度,原始缩放比例为1.0,即网页初始大小占屏幕面积的100%。所有主流浏览器都支持这个设置,包括IE9。如果没有这行代码, 手机浏览器会默认按照桌面端的宽度来渲染页面然后缩放到手机屏幕大小,后来啊就是字小得像蚂蚁,用户得不停地放大缩小,体验极差。
2. CSS3与Media Query的魔法
行吧... 有了viewport只是第一步,接下来才是重头戏。自适应网页设计的核心,就是CSS3引入的Media Query模块。这就像是给网页装上了“眼睛”,它能感知当前屏幕的大小,然后根据预设的规则来改变样式。
比如 你可以设置当屏幕宽度小于768像素时隐藏掉侧边栏,把导航栏变成一个汉堡菜单,或者把字体调大一点。这种灵活性,才是自适应的精髓。通过设置弹性容器和子元素的属性,可以实现网页在不同分辨率下的自适应效果。当然如果你不想从头写这些复杂的CSS, 太刺激了。 使用响应式框架也是一种快速且高效的方式。一些流行的响应式框架如Bootstrap和Foundation提供了各种预定义的网格系统和组件,使开发者能够快速搭建出适应不同屏幕的网页。
二、 图片自适应:别让流量成为用户的痛
既然让图片自适应不同的屏幕,也就是说不光是pc端还有移动端。我们给div设置好背景图之后由于没有给div设置高度,背景图是看不到的。这里有个细节,如果我们用手机端去访问我们的页面那么就需要把图片下载到本地, 客观地说... 这就要需要流量。用户肯定希望流量越少越好啊,谁愿意为了看一张可能根本显示不出来的背景图而浪费几十兆流量呢?
杀疯了! HTML设置背景图片自适应,如何使背景图片自适应浏览器大小?这里我们可以通过css3的background属性设置宽度缩放。在文件夹中创建css文件夹里面是css文件、hello图片、test的html文件。打开test的html文件,在里面添加class为scale的div,里面放一张hello图片。在浏览器中打开发现会一直保持大小,并不会缩放,这明摆着不是我们想要的。
1. 简单的CSS技巧
拜托大家... 要让图片听话,其实很简单。对于普通的标签,我们只需要一行CSS:img { max-width: 100%; }。这行代码的意思是图片的最大宽度不能超过其容器的宽度。如果容器变小了图片也会跟着缩小,但不会超过原始尺寸,防止图片被拉伸模糊。
而对于背景图片,情况稍微复杂一点。我们需要用到background-size属性。比如background-size: cover;可以让背景图覆盖整个容器,哪怕这意味着图片的边缘会被裁剪掉。或者background-size: contain;则保证图片完整显示,哪怕留白。细节上要注意, ../ 表示的是返回上一级目录访问,tuxiang/ 表示访问的是同级目录中的tuxian。这些路径如果写错了图片可就彻底“走丢”了。
2. 预取引擎技术的加持
弄一下... 除了图片本身的优化,加载速度也是关键。预取引擎技术,引领新的上网速度革命,给您带来秒开网页的超快体验。打开css文件夹中的hello的css文件,在里面设置scale img的属性background-size与width。这不仅仅是代码的堆砌,更是对用户耐心的尊重。如何使用css给图片加上圆形边框, 或者如何让图片在加载时有一个模糊到清晰的过渡,这些微小的细节,往往能决定用户对网站的专业度评价。
三、 网站风格统一:别让用户眼花缭乱
在网站建设中,不要随意使用过多的不同配色方案,那会给用户造成很凌乱的视觉感受。这种情况下很多用户会产生不舒适感,而后选择关闭网站离开。所以设计网页时结合企业的文化、行业类型、用户偏好等要素保持版面风格一致。
自适应网站要符合企业形象。可以把企业新颖的发展情况、 企业现状、目标、文化等展示出来让企业以很好的状态,把企业现状展示给来访者。让访问者对企业有一个初步肯定。如果企业网站和自己的企业现象不符合,会给访问者留下不信任的影响。这种信任感一旦崩塌,想要重建就难如登天了,牛逼。。
1. 字体与兼容性的那些事儿
大家都知道, 在IE浏览器的功能设置中,有一个可以自由设置窗口内容字体大小的功能,这样由于不同访问者的设置习惯不同,呈现在他们面前的网页有时也会不不相同。虽然没有办法做出让所有浏览器都兼容的网站, 但只要注意以下几点,做出来的网页在各个浏览器都中能达到比较好的显示效果,被割韭菜了。。
如果只是主要原因是浏览者改变了浏览器的设置, 或者主要原因是浏览器不兼容,使自己精心制作的网页变得面目全非,那真是太让人沮丧了。所以 尽量使用相对单位而不是绝对单位,这样当用户调整浏览器字体大小时网页布局也能随之优雅地调整,而不是崩坏,上手。。
四、 清晰明了的导航栏设计:做用户的引路人
导航是网页中的“引路人”,能方便用户在网页中迅速寻找所需,在网站设计过程中,要做面包屑导航。通过面包屑导航能确保每一个页面都能访问到网站的主页, 也是可以让用户能顺利的从一个网页跳转到再说一个一个网页,相互嵌套,而不出现混淆或者迷路的情况。
归根结底。 想象一下你走进一个巨大的迷宫,如果没有指示牌,你会是什么心情?网站也是一样。特别是对于移动端用户,屏幕空间有限,导航栏的设计更是要精简、高效。不要把所有链接都塞进导航里要学会做减法。把最重要的功能放在最显眼的位置,其他的可以折叠到二级菜单里。
五、实战技巧与工具选择
说了这么多理论,咱们来点实际的。今天制作html5网页,需要网页兼容各种屏幕大小的设备,里面的图片自适应屏幕的宽度。除了手写CSS,我们还有很多工具可以利用,醉了...。
比如有些浏览器本身就提供了辅助功能。360浏览器是可以设置网页自适应屏幕的,那么如何设置呢?下面给大家简单介绍一下:先说说在手机中打开360浏览器, 绝绝子... 点击正下方的功能图标,将开关打开即可完成。虽然这是浏览器端的补救措施,但也说明了自适应的重要性。
对于开发者选择加载css是关键。自适应网页设计的核心,就是CSS3引入的Media Query模块。当然 如果你觉得手写Media Query太麻烦,Bootstrap和Foundation这些框架里的网格系统简直是救星。它们把复杂的计算都封装好了 你只需要像搭积木一样,把内容放进对应的col-md-4或者col-xs-12这样的类里布局就自动完成了,踩雷了。。
可以让网页的宽度自动适应手机屏幕的宽度。代码如下。
六、 :技术是有温度的
拉倒吧... 网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有做网站、自适应网站等。但归根结底,我们做的不是代码,不是布局,而是连接。
说句可能得罪人的话... 当你给用户一个更快、更佳的体验,或许就是你能给他们的最好的温柔。
一句话概括... 互联网早已不是那个只属于大屏幕桌面的世界了。你有没有想过当用户在地铁上、在排队买咖啡时掏出手机点开你的网站,他们期待的是什么?不仅仅是信息的获取,更是一种行云流水的快感。如果网页加载慢吞吞,或者布局乱七八糟,用户的心里恐怕早就默默关掉了页面。这就是为什么我们今天要聊一聊“自适应网站建设”这个话题。这不仅仅是一个技术活,更是一场关于用户体验的博弈。
一、 自适应网站:不仅仅是屏幕的缩小
常说的自适应网站,其实是指同一站点、同一页面可以在电脑、手机、平板和各类设备上正常浏览的站点。听起来很美好,对吧?但很多网站的做法是对不同终端设计多个网页,这简直是维护的噩梦。试想一下你要维护两套甚至三套代码,一旦有个新闻要更新,你得改好几遍,这谁受得了,吃瓜。?
所以 聪明的做法是设计一个简单的“盒子”,这个盒子可以识别不同的终端而显示不同的效果。移动设备正超过桌面设备,成为访问互联网的最常见终端。如果你的网站不能适应这种变化,那就像是在智能手机时代还坚持用BP机一样, 闹笑话。 显得格格不入。通过自适应网站提升品牌形象, 使之符合时代的节拍,让品牌保持新鲜感和吸引力,从而使品牌焕发出新的生命活力,是品牌能够持续发展的关键。
1. 那个神奇的Viewport标签
自适应网页设计到底是做到的?其实并不难,但有一个前提,那就是你得告诉浏览器:“嘿, 绝了... 别假装自己是电脑,请按照手机屏幕的宽度来显示。”
先说说 在网页代码的头部,加入一行 viewport元标签:。这行代码的意思是 网页宽度默认等于屏幕宽度,原始缩放比例为1.0,即网页初始大小占屏幕面积的100%。所有主流浏览器都支持这个设置,包括IE9。如果没有这行代码, 手机浏览器会默认按照桌面端的宽度来渲染页面然后缩放到手机屏幕大小,后来啊就是字小得像蚂蚁,用户得不停地放大缩小,体验极差。
2. CSS3与Media Query的魔法
行吧... 有了viewport只是第一步,接下来才是重头戏。自适应网页设计的核心,就是CSS3引入的Media Query模块。这就像是给网页装上了“眼睛”,它能感知当前屏幕的大小,然后根据预设的规则来改变样式。
比如 你可以设置当屏幕宽度小于768像素时隐藏掉侧边栏,把导航栏变成一个汉堡菜单,或者把字体调大一点。这种灵活性,才是自适应的精髓。通过设置弹性容器和子元素的属性,可以实现网页在不同分辨率下的自适应效果。当然如果你不想从头写这些复杂的CSS, 太刺激了。 使用响应式框架也是一种快速且高效的方式。一些流行的响应式框架如Bootstrap和Foundation提供了各种预定义的网格系统和组件,使开发者能够快速搭建出适应不同屏幕的网页。
二、 图片自适应:别让流量成为用户的痛
既然让图片自适应不同的屏幕,也就是说不光是pc端还有移动端。我们给div设置好背景图之后由于没有给div设置高度,背景图是看不到的。这里有个细节,如果我们用手机端去访问我们的页面那么就需要把图片下载到本地, 客观地说... 这就要需要流量。用户肯定希望流量越少越好啊,谁愿意为了看一张可能根本显示不出来的背景图而浪费几十兆流量呢?
杀疯了! HTML设置背景图片自适应,如何使背景图片自适应浏览器大小?这里我们可以通过css3的background属性设置宽度缩放。在文件夹中创建css文件夹里面是css文件、hello图片、test的html文件。打开test的html文件,在里面添加class为scale的div,里面放一张hello图片。在浏览器中打开发现会一直保持大小,并不会缩放,这明摆着不是我们想要的。
1. 简单的CSS技巧
拜托大家... 要让图片听话,其实很简单。对于普通的标签,我们只需要一行CSS:img { max-width: 100%; }。这行代码的意思是图片的最大宽度不能超过其容器的宽度。如果容器变小了图片也会跟着缩小,但不会超过原始尺寸,防止图片被拉伸模糊。
而对于背景图片,情况稍微复杂一点。我们需要用到background-size属性。比如background-size: cover;可以让背景图覆盖整个容器,哪怕这意味着图片的边缘会被裁剪掉。或者background-size: contain;则保证图片完整显示,哪怕留白。细节上要注意, ../ 表示的是返回上一级目录访问,tuxiang/ 表示访问的是同级目录中的tuxian。这些路径如果写错了图片可就彻底“走丢”了。
2. 预取引擎技术的加持
弄一下... 除了图片本身的优化,加载速度也是关键。预取引擎技术,引领新的上网速度革命,给您带来秒开网页的超快体验。打开css文件夹中的hello的css文件,在里面设置scale img的属性background-size与width。这不仅仅是代码的堆砌,更是对用户耐心的尊重。如何使用css给图片加上圆形边框, 或者如何让图片在加载时有一个模糊到清晰的过渡,这些微小的细节,往往能决定用户对网站的专业度评价。
三、 网站风格统一:别让用户眼花缭乱
在网站建设中,不要随意使用过多的不同配色方案,那会给用户造成很凌乱的视觉感受。这种情况下很多用户会产生不舒适感,而后选择关闭网站离开。所以设计网页时结合企业的文化、行业类型、用户偏好等要素保持版面风格一致。
自适应网站要符合企业形象。可以把企业新颖的发展情况、 企业现状、目标、文化等展示出来让企业以很好的状态,把企业现状展示给来访者。让访问者对企业有一个初步肯定。如果企业网站和自己的企业现象不符合,会给访问者留下不信任的影响。这种信任感一旦崩塌,想要重建就难如登天了,牛逼。。
1. 字体与兼容性的那些事儿
大家都知道, 在IE浏览器的功能设置中,有一个可以自由设置窗口内容字体大小的功能,这样由于不同访问者的设置习惯不同,呈现在他们面前的网页有时也会不不相同。虽然没有办法做出让所有浏览器都兼容的网站, 但只要注意以下几点,做出来的网页在各个浏览器都中能达到比较好的显示效果,被割韭菜了。。
如果只是主要原因是浏览者改变了浏览器的设置, 或者主要原因是浏览器不兼容,使自己精心制作的网页变得面目全非,那真是太让人沮丧了。所以 尽量使用相对单位而不是绝对单位,这样当用户调整浏览器字体大小时网页布局也能随之优雅地调整,而不是崩坏,上手。。
四、 清晰明了的导航栏设计:做用户的引路人
导航是网页中的“引路人”,能方便用户在网页中迅速寻找所需,在网站设计过程中,要做面包屑导航。通过面包屑导航能确保每一个页面都能访问到网站的主页, 也是可以让用户能顺利的从一个网页跳转到再说一个一个网页,相互嵌套,而不出现混淆或者迷路的情况。
归根结底。 想象一下你走进一个巨大的迷宫,如果没有指示牌,你会是什么心情?网站也是一样。特别是对于移动端用户,屏幕空间有限,导航栏的设计更是要精简、高效。不要把所有链接都塞进导航里要学会做减法。把最重要的功能放在最显眼的位置,其他的可以折叠到二级菜单里。
五、实战技巧与工具选择
说了这么多理论,咱们来点实际的。今天制作html5网页,需要网页兼容各种屏幕大小的设备,里面的图片自适应屏幕的宽度。除了手写CSS,我们还有很多工具可以利用,醉了...。
比如有些浏览器本身就提供了辅助功能。360浏览器是可以设置网页自适应屏幕的,那么如何设置呢?下面给大家简单介绍一下:先说说在手机中打开360浏览器, 绝绝子... 点击正下方的功能图标,将开关打开即可完成。虽然这是浏览器端的补救措施,但也说明了自适应的重要性。
对于开发者选择加载css是关键。自适应网页设计的核心,就是CSS3引入的Media Query模块。当然 如果你觉得手写Media Query太麻烦,Bootstrap和Foundation这些框架里的网格系统简直是救星。它们把复杂的计算都封装好了 你只需要像搭积木一样,把内容放进对应的col-md-4或者col-xs-12这样的类里布局就自动完成了,踩雷了。。
可以让网页的宽度自动适应手机屏幕的宽度。代码如下。
六、 :技术是有温度的
拉倒吧... 网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有做网站、自适应网站等。但归根结底,我们做的不是代码,不是布局,而是连接。
说句可能得罪人的话... 当你给用户一个更快、更佳的体验,或许就是你能给他们的最好的温柔。

